The package contains a CD - 33 min. running time - and a DVD with live footage and off stage material. Additionally there is a comic with the story of Metalian. Sounds good, right? Unfortunately the packages Metalian Attack don't fulfil the expectations!
First surprise when I started the DVD... A Spanish introduction! I don't speak Spanish and from an international release I expect an English introduction, probably additionally in another language... Even if the DVD was produced in Spain. Okay, let's go on!
The menu is a bad joke! The background image shows the Metalium logo, but it looks like it's done from a small print or it's just badly scanned. On the logo are yellow edged letters. Nice. It lists the 28 parts (listing see below) of this DVD. It's good that there is a live CD included, coz so you can enjoy t more. Changing the locations during the songs is annoying, coz they mixed festival performances with club shows. Why that?
Next I have to criticize the realization of the travel through the bands history. Okay, it's very detailed and gives a lot of information. It's only in one language. Mainman Lars Ratz speaks English. Why not using more tracks? Why isn't the image synchronized with the sound? Anyway, the sound is quite good. The camera moves and the fading in and out is not very convincing. Only the parts which were recorded in New York and during the recordings can convince me. Another nice piece is the part about the 'making of' the cover artwork of Metalium.
On other DVDs you find some words from the band, a photo section and sometimes even more stuff. Anyway, my rèsumé is that you can spend your money on better DVDs! Sorry guys, but there are hundreds of bands who did a better job! Not a waste of money at all, but....
